Understanding Roof Ventilation


Roof ventilation is very important for the health and life of your home, especially in Columbus, GA. It's not only about moving air around. A good ventilation system also controls temperature and moisture in your attic.


Keeping this balance can stop problems like mold, wood rot, and early damage to shingles. If you are thinking about roof replacement or want to boost how well your current roof works, knowing the basics of ventilation is key.


The Basics Of Roof Ventilation Systems


Roof ventilation works based on a simple idea. Cool, dry air comes into the attic through lower vents, like soffit vents. At the same time, warm, moist air leaves through upper vents, like ridge vents or roof vents. This steady air flow stops heat and humidity from causing damage to your roof and home.


What type of ventilation system is right for your home depends on a few things. These include roof design, pitch, and local climate. Shingle roofing often works well with both ridge vents and soffit vents because of its slope.

Signs Of Poor Roof Ventilation In Your Home


Inadequate roof ventilation can show up in different ways around your home. Spotting these signs early can help you fix the issue before it leads to costly repairs and health risks. Here are some signs to watch for:


  • Moisture Damage: Check your ceilings and walls for water stains or discoloration, especially near the roof.
  • Mold Growth: Mold loves warm and humid spots. Look in your attic and crawl spaces for black spots or fuzzy growth that means mold is present.
  • High Energy Costs: Bad ventilation makes your HVAC system work harder. This can lead to higher energy use and larger utility bills.

Moisture Damage And Mold Growth


Poor ventilation not only raises your energy bills, but it also allows mold and mildew to thrive. Moisture can get trapped in your attic. When it cools down, it can condense on surfaces like roof sheathing, insulation, and rafters. This can lead to rot and decay.


Mold can be a serious health risk. It can cause allergies, breathing problems, and other health issues. Fixing moisture damage and getting rid of mold often means needing major roof repair or even a complete roof replacement.

Using A Ridge Vent System


For better air flow, think about a ridge vent system. Ridge vents go at the top of your roof. They help hot, humid air to escape easily. This system works best when used with soffit vents, which bring in cool, fresh air.

Adding Soffit Vents


Soffit vents go under the eaves of your roof. They are key for bringing cool, dry air into your attic. They work together with exhaust vents, like ridge vents. This helps create a steady flow of air that keeps temperature and moisture in check.

Utilizing Attic Fans Or Ventilation Systems


In situations where there is not enough natural airflow, adding attic fans or powered ventilation systems can help a lot. These systems work by pushing out hot, humid air from your attic. This helps to lower moisture and cool down the attic temperature.


Powered ventilation systems are great for areas with high humidity or homes that don't have much air moving naturally. They are good because they remove extra heat, which can lessen the load on your air conditioner. This can lead to lower energy bills.
